Howdy.

Quick question regarding etiquette here: Does a starter that doesn't have a claim on it, and no replies to it, constitute an open invitation?

For example, I understand Title (Username x Username) is clearly for a particular set of people. But if it were just Title, with no replies, is that a green light for me to jump in and begin the RP? (I know that I should read OPs Request Thread first).

I'm asking both so I don't jump into someone else's thread and so that when I decide to post a starter that I'm not waiting for someone to join for nothing. In my days of regular RP the norm was to just basically cast a line and see who responded first.
